Overall Meaning

The lyrics of The Beat's song "End of the Party" seem to be about a woman who is encouraging someone to express their love for her, but at the same time warning him that if he misses this opportunity, there won't be another chance. She urges him to "do it now", indicating that the time for hesitation is over. The feeling of the party just starting is juxtaposed with the reality that it's almost over, which could be a metaphor for the fleeting nature of love and relationships. The lines about the bees being busy and gold on the hill could be referring to the vibrant energy of the world around them, in contrast to the potentially missed connection between two people. The chorus repeats the plea to "pull back your cover", which could be interpreted as a metaphor for revealing one's true emotions and vulnerability.


The second half of the song seems to be somewhat fragmented and cryptic. The singer talks about treating someone like a baby and the difference between strength and anger. It's possible that these lines are meant to illustrate the complexity of relationships and the various emotions that can be involved. The line about "putting the taste back into hunger" could be a metaphor for reigniting passion or desire. The repeated plea to "treat him like a baby please" could be a call for gentle handling and understanding.


Overall, the lyrics of "End of the Party" suggest a sense of urgency and a desire to express love before it's too late. The whimsical metaphors and poetic language create a dreamy, wistful mood.
